An organization's future success depends on their decision makers' ability to anticipate changes and disruptions in the marketplace. But how do you get information about tomorrow today? How can your decisions today account for tomorrow's uncertainties?
Small Data, Big Disruptions presents a tool kit to foresee coming changes:
- Understand why big data will not help you with understanding tomorrow's disruptions. The future starts with small data-first.
- Learn the proven 4-step process to capture small data that help envision the future.
- See examples of how the process anticipated major disruptions.
- Implement the process in your organization and learn how to initiate meaningful actions.
Small Data, Big Disruptions
lets you exploit the period between the moment you could know about emerging disruptions and the moment most everybody will know about it. It's the difference between being ahead of the curve and struggling to catch up.
